msjackhammer wrote:Great work Pat! I'm Jack Mallette, T.J's dad, and I have a freezer full of ducks I'd like to get mounted. How long do they keep in the freezer? Also, how much for a single mount, and a triple mount on the driftwood like you showed in the pic? And where seems the best place to shoot a Cinnamon Teal? That's #1 on my Most Wanted list. Thanks!
__________________________________
"Mighty bold talk for a one-eyed fat man!"
West coast of Mexico has lots of Cinnamons. I can hook you up down there. Febuary Cinnamons are exqusite.




Birds can be kept for several years in a freezer, but it depends on how well they are wrapped. $200 each but will go to $225 3/1.
